Transaction e642532e37bf712499a4909684a35321813eb7459fa7387921eb20d4d954a03a
1 Input
1 Output
-
e642532e37bf712499a4909684a35321813eb7459fa7387921eb20d4d954a03a: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 807ab53cb39a9f1d7e453c7f8d538827bb43ad4261f7ce70c6797ff0547e5d9c
- address
- bc1pspat209nn2036lj983lc65ugy7a58t2zv8muuuxx09llq4r7tkwq6m8sjv